What Type of Medicine is Norvir (Ritonavir)?

Norvir is a prescription-only medication that functions as an antiviral agent specifically within the class of antiretroviral drugs. Its sole active ingredient is the chemically synthetic compound Ritonavir (RTV), which is pharmacologically classified as a Protease Inhibitor (PI). This specific classification indicates its established role in disrupting the life cycle of the Human Immunodeficiency Virus (HIV). Ritonavir was initially developed by Abbott Laboratories and is manufactured for global use, highlighting its long-standing presence in treatment protocols.


Composition, Origin, and Available Forms

Norvir is a single-ingredient product available for oral administration in three distinct dosage forms to accommodate various patient needs: the film-coated tablet, a capsule, and an oral solution. This choice of preparation is particularly relevant for pediatric patients and others who may have difficulty swallowing solid medications. A key differentiating feature of the oral solution is that it is formulated with excipients to mask the naturally bitter metallic taste of Ritonavir. The Ritonavir active substance itself is chemically synthesized, utilizing pharmaceutical excipients appropriate for its solid and liquid oral forms to ensure proper delivery into the systemic circulation.


General Purpose and Pharmacological Role

The general purpose of Norvir is to serve as a cornerstone in antiretroviral therapy (ART) through its unique dual function. While it is a Protease Inhibitor that contributes to the suppression of the HIV viral load, its key pharmacological role is that of a pharmacokinetic enhancer or boosting agent. This boosting mechanism is essential for maintaining effective drug levels, as it increases and sustains the therapeutic plasma concentrations of other co-administered antiretroviral agents in the bloodstream. This action helps the companion medicines work better and for a longer time, which is fundamental for achieving sustained viral suppression.

What side effects are possible with Norvir?

Possible Side Effects and Safety Information

The safety profile of Norvir (ritonavir) is officially classified by regulatory authorities based on the frequency and system-organ class of documented adverse reactions. The most frequently reported adverse events are primarily related to the Gastrointestinal and Nervous systems.


Key Adverse Reaction Classifications

Classification Examples of Officially Listed Reactions
Very Common Diarrhea, Nausea, Vomiting, Abdominal pain, Paresthesia, Headache, Fatigue/Asthenia
Common Anorexia, Hypercholesterolemia, Dizziness, Dysgeusia, Rash, Peripheral edema
Uncommon Jaundice, Hepatitis, Acute Pancreatitis, Nephrolithiasis (kidney stones)

Serious Adverse Reactions and Safety Constraints

The official labeling highlights several serious adverse reactions, including cases of fatal Hepatotoxicity (liver damage) and Pancreatitis. Severe, life-threatening Hypersensitivity Reactions, such as Stevens-Johnson syndrome, have also been documented. Specific Cardiac Events, including PR interval prolongation and second- or third-degree heart block, are noted in the safety warnings.

Safety constraints exist for specific patient groups. Use is contraindicated in individuals with decompensated liver disease. Caution and monitoring are advised for patients with pre-existing hepatic disease, as well as those with Hemophilia Type A and B, due to reports of increased bleeding events. Time-related safety patterns indicate that frequent gastrointestinal effects and paresthesias may diminish as therapy is continued, while Immune Reconstitution Syndrome (IRIS) is typically observed during the initial phases of combination treatment.

Overdose and Emergency Response

Overdose and When to Seek Help

Official regulatory information addresses the required actions and clinical signs associated with an overdose of Norvir (Ritonavir).

Documented Overdose Manifestations

The human experience with a Ritonavir overdose is limited. The only specific clinical sign documented following supratherapeutic exposure (1000 mg daily for three days) was paresthesia (a sensation of tingling or numbness) affecting the peripheral nervous system. No specific life-threatening events are directly reported in association with Norvir overdose alone.

Required Emergency Actions

If an overdose is suspected or confirmed, regulatory guidelines require the patient to contact a healthcare provider or local poison control center right away. Immediate access to care is mandated, and patients should go to the nearest hospital emergency room.

Management and Monitoring

  • Antidote: No specific antidote is known for Ritonavir overdose.
  • Management: Treatment involves general supportive measures and removing unabsorbed drug using procedures like emesis (vomiting) or gastric lavage (stomach pump).
  • Observation: Frequent monitoring of vital signs and observation of the patient's overall clinical status are required during management.

Population-Specific Consideration

Regulatory authorities place special attention on the Norvir oral solution when dispensed to young children. This is to minimize the risk of overdose and potential excipient toxicity, requiring accurate dose calculation and careful administration.

Eligibility and Restrictions for Use

Norvir (ritonavir) is approved for use in combination with other antiretroviral agents to treat Human Immunodeficiency Virus-1 (HIV-1) infection in adults and children one month of age and older. It is most commonly used in a low dose as a "booster" to increase the effectiveness of other protease inhibitor medications.


Contraindications and Precautions

Norvir is contraindicated in patients with a known hypersensitivity to ritonavir or any of its ingredients. It must not be used in combination with numerous medications, as the interaction can lead to serious or life-threatening events. Your doctor must review all other medicines and herbal supplements you take, including St. John's Wort.

Special caution and close monitoring are required for patients with pre-existing conditions, including:

Patient Condition Important Consideration
Severe Liver Disease Not recommended, especially in decompensated liver disease.
Heart Problems Use with caution due to risk of heart rhythm changes (e.g., PR interval prolongation).
Diabetes/Hyperglycemia May cause new onset or worsening of high blood sugar.
Hemophilia Increased risk of spontaneous bleeding has been reported.
Pregnancy The oral solution formulation is not recommended due to its alcohol content.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Norvir (ritonavir) has a high potential for drug-drug interactions because it is a potent inhibitor of the metabolic enzyme Cytochrome P450 3A (CYP3A), and also affects other enzymes like CYP2D6. This action can significantly increase the blood concentration of co-administered medicines that are cleared by these pathways, raising the risk of serious or life-threatening adverse events.

Contraindicated Combinations

Co-administration with several drug classes is strictly contraindicated. These include specific antiarrhythmics (e.g., amiodarone, flecainide, propafenone), sedative hypnotics (e.g., oral midazolam, triazolam), and ergot derivatives (e.g., ergotamine, dihydroergotamine). These combinations may cause severe toxicity. Products that significantly reduce ritonavir levels, such as the herbal product St. John's Wort, are also contraindicated, as they can lead to a loss of the drug's therapeutic effect.

Other Significant Interactions

Norvir also induces certain liver enzymes, which can lead to decreased blood levels of other medicines, potentially causing them to lose their effect. When used with other protease inhibitors, a dose reduction of Norvir is often required due to changes in drug concentrations. Caution is advised when Norvir is co-administered with drugs that may prolong the PR interval of the heart.

The potential for drug interactions must be thoroughly reviewed by a healthcare provider before and during Norvir therapy.

Mechanism of Action

Norvir (Ritonavir) operates through two primary mechanistic domains. Its direct, original function is as a peptidomimetic inhibitor that binds selectively to the active site of the HIV-1 Protease enzyme. This interaction prevents the essential cleavage of the gag and pol viral polyprotein precursors into functional components, resulting in the formation of immature, non-infectious viral particles.

The drug's most frequent current function is its pharmacokinetic modulation role. It acts as a mechanism-based inhibitor of the human liver and intestinal enzyme Cytochrome P450 3A4 (CYP3A4). This enzymatic inhibition slows the metabolic processing and catabolism of co-administered drug substrates, leading to an alteration in the metabolic clearance rate. This action is further supported by Norvir's inhibitory effect on the cellular efflux pump P-glycoprotein (P-gp). Interference with these metabolic cascades also results in alterations in endogenous lipid and glucose metabolic pathways.

Dosage and Administration Information

Norvir (ritonavir) is administered orally and must be taken with meals. Consistent administration with food is required to optimize absorption and improve tolerability.

Labeled Dosing and Administration

Administration Scope Official Guideline
Route of Administration Oral.
Timing in Relation to Meals Must be taken with meals.
Adult Standard Dosing When used as a full antiretroviral, the recommended dosage is 600 mg twice daily (BID). A dose titration schedule may be used, starting at no less than 300 mg BID and increasing incrementally to the maximum dose over 2 to 3 day intervals.
Pediatric Dosing The recommended BID dose for children older than one month is based on Body Surface Area (m^2) and should not exceed 600 mg BID. The oral solution is not recommended for neonates before a postmenstrual age of 44 weeks.
Tablet/Capsule Use Norvir tablets must be swallowed whole and should not be chewed, broken, or crushed.
Oral Solution/Powder Use The oral solution may be mixed with certain food or liquids (e.g., chocolate milk) and must be administered within one hour of mixing. The oral powder must be mixed with soft food or liquid and administered within two hours.
Missed Dose Rule If a dose is missed, take the dose as soon as possible, and then return to the regular schedule. The dose should not be doubled to make up for a missed dose.

Frequently Asked Questions (FAQ)

Common questions about Norvir (FAQ)

Q: Why is dose adherence so important when taking Norvir?

A: Norvir's role is critical for maintaining effective and sustained blood levels of the other antiviral drugs in a regimen by slowing their breakdown. Official information notes that consistent dosing (adherence) helps support the overall effectiveness of the treatment regimen and may reduce the risk of the HIV virus developing resistance.

Q: Do people on Norvir need to change their diet?

A: The official product information specifies that Norvir is typically taken with meals to help improve its absorption and tolerability. Beyond this requirement for timing with food, no general, specific diet changes are mandated in the official labeling.

Q: What are the signs of a serious, but rare, side effect from Norvir?

A: Serious adverse reactions noted in safety warnings include severe liver damage (Hepatotoxicity), Pancreatitis, and serious allergic reactions. If symptoms of a serious reaction occur, such as severe pain or tenderness in the upper stomach, nausea, vomiting, dark urine, or signs of an allergic reaction like a severe rash or swelling of the face, mouth, or throat, regulatory information advises consulting a healthcare professional immediately.

Q: Can Norvir cause skin rashes or reactions?

A: Yes, official adverse reaction reports classify rash as a frequently observed side effect. Regulatory documents also note that severe, potentially life-threatening skin reactions, including Stevens-Johnson syndrome and toxic epidermal necrolysis (TEN), have been reported in rare cases.

Q: Can Norvir affect sleep patterns or cause insomnia?

A: Regulatory information, including postmarketing experience reports, indicate that insomnia (difficulty sleeping) and disturbance in attention have been reported as common adverse reactions. Less frequently, sleepiness or unusual drowsiness has also been reported.

Q: Can Norvir impact a person's mood or cause anxiety?

A: Official documents listing adverse reactions from clinical trials and postmarketing experience include reports of anxiety, confusion, and other changes related to mood or mental health.

Q: Are there any specific warnings for people with kidney problems taking Norvir?

A: Regulatory documents list kidney stones (nephrolithiasis) as an adverse event that has been reported in patients taking ritonavir. Official prescribing information advises that patients with a history of kidney problems should be monitored by a healthcare professional.

Q: How often do I need blood tests while taking Norvir?

A: Official safety guidelines recommend monitoring. Liver function tests and total cholesterol and triglyceride levels should be monitored before and periodically during therapy with Norvir.

Q: Is Norvir considered safe for people with pre-existing heart conditions?

A: Official regulatory information advises caution for patients with pre-existing heart conditions because Norvir may lead to changes in heart rhythm, specifically PR interval prolongation. A healthcare provider must review a patient's full medical history, especially concerning pre-existing heart conditions, before starting therapy.

Q: Can Norvir cause mouth ulcers or changes in taste?

A: Official adverse reaction reports include dysgeusia (a change in the sense of taste) and a sensation of tingling or numbness in the mouth (oral paresthesia). Mouth ulcers are not explicitly listed among the key adverse reactions.

Q: Does Norvir interact with any common birth control pills?

A: Yes, official regulatory information indicates that Norvir can alter the blood concentrations of many hormonal contraceptives. It is important that a healthcare provider reviews the complete prescribing information for both medications to manage potential interaction risks.

Q: What happens if I stop taking Norvir suddenly?

A: Norvir is always used as part of a combination regimen for HIV-1. Stopping Norvir suddenly can reduce the blood concentrations of co-administered medicines, which could result in a loss of the treatment's effect. Regulatory warnings indicate that patients should not stop taking Norvir without first consulting a healthcare professional.

Q: How is Norvir different from other HIV medications, like PIs?

A: Norvir is technically classified as a Protease Inhibitor (PI), but its main clinical role is as a pharmacokinetic enhancer (or 'booster'). Regulatory documents explain that it works primarily by inhibiting the CYP3A4 enzyme, which then increases and sustains the blood levels of other co-administered PIs, enhancing the overall treatment regimen.

Q: Is Norvir used to treat Hepatitis C or other conditions besides HIV?

A: Norvir is only officially approved by the FDA for the treatment of HIV-1 infection. While its boosting effect has led to its inclusion in some combination treatments for other conditions, such as Hepatitis C or COVID-19, this use is based on its drug-boosting property, not its direct approval for these specific conditions.

Q: Why do some treatment guidelines still recommend using Norvir?

A: According to official guidelines, Norvir is still recommended because its unique function as a pharmacokinetic enhancer is considered critical. It reliably boosts the concentration of other protease inhibitors, which remains a key strategy for achieving sustained viral suppression in HIV-1 treatment.

Q: Are there any studies comparing Norvir with other boosting agents?

A: Official regulatory labeling describes the mechanism of Norvir's boosting action (CYP3A4 inhibition) in detail within the clinical pharmacology section. While this information is provided, regulatory documents typically focus on the drug's properties and do not include direct comparisons to other specific boosting agents.

Q: Is it safe to drink alcohol while on Norvir?

A: Official regulatory documents indicate that the oral solution formulation of Norvir contains ethanol (alcohol) and is therefore not recommended during pregnancy due to this content. Patients are generally advised to discuss the use of alcohol with a healthcare professional, as interactions may occur with certain medicines.

How should Norvir be stored and disposed of?

Storage and Disposal of Norvir (ritonavir)

Norvir storage requirements vary by formulation. Norvir tablets must be stored at room temperature between 15°C and 30°C and kept in the original, tightly closed container to protect them from high humidity. The oral solution requires room temperature storage between 20°C and 25°C, and refrigeration is not required.

All forms of Norvir must be stored out of the sight and reach of children.

Stability and Disposal

The oral powder, when mixed with food or liquid, is only stable for 2 hours and must be discarded if not consumed within that timeframe. Expired or unused Norvir must be thrown away by following the official guidelines for the safe disposal of unused medicines.
